What's The Definition Of Keeve?Synonyms | Synonyms for Keeve: Related Terms | Find terms related to Keeve: See Also | Keeve In Webster's Dictionary \Keeve\, n. [AS. c?f, fr. L. cupa a tub, cask; also, F.
cuve. Cf. {Kive}, {Coop}.]
1. (Brewing) A vat or tub in which the mash is made; a mash
tub. --Ure.
2. (Bleaching) A bleaching vat; a kier.
3. (Mining) A large vat used in dressing ores.
\Keeve\, v. t. [imp. & p. p. {Keeved}; p. pr. & vb. n. {Keeving}.] 1. To set in a keeve, or tub, for fermentation. 2. To heave; to tilt, as a cart. [Prov. Eng.] |
